Yes, you may have hydrolocked your engine. Basically, if the water is high enough it goes through the air filter, down the air intake and into the engine. Do you have a cone type high flow air filter or the OEM Audi Box Air filter setup?

if he got that much water in the engine and it has hydrolocked with the low temps, like -10 it might have pushed the gaskets........so if they get it started check for oil contamination and leaks.....well they should dump the oil before they even try to start it, but they wont.
